android-sdcard相关内容
我正在开发一款具有录制用户语音功能的android应用。为此,我使用了AndroidRecord Audio API。 当前在SD卡中成功生成了pcm文件(已录制的音频文件-recordedAudio.pcm)。但是无法播放该文件。我也在PC上尝试了Windows Media Palyer和其他一些播放器。但是没有任何帮助。 以下是我的代码段。 private int minB
..
每次尝试读取SD卡(可移动存储)的信息时,我都会遇到android.system.ErrnoException:statvfs失败:EACCES(权限被拒绝) 我在清单文件中添加了权限:
..
我正在使用 android.media.MediaRecorder 类录制视频,该类接受输出文件的路径字符串( MediaRecorder.setOutputFile(String) ),尽管该方法有一个版本可以接受 FileDescriptor 。 我需要存储大量视频文件,所以我要使用SD卡。为了获取相关目录的路径,我使用 Environment.getExternalStoragePub
..
我正在尝试将拨入和拨出电话记录存储在我的SD卡中.但问题是我无法在我的SD卡中找到它.以下是我的代码谁能帮忙 DeviceAdminDemo.java public class DeviceAdminDemo extends DeviceAdminReceiver { @Override public void onReceive(Context context, In
..
声明是否足够?还是必须声明? Javadocs忽略了这一重要信息. 解决方案 READ_E
..
当我要在外部SD卡(名为/storage/B9BE-18A6)上创建文件时,出现“拒绝权限"错误. 我知道自Android M以来,您必须以编程方式请求写入权限.因此,我从Arpit Patel(我不知道为什么我仍然没有这样做的权限. 你们还有其他解决方案,可以在SD卡上创建文件吗? 用于创建文件的代码 FloatingActionButton fab_new_file
..
我有一个将重要数据写入SDCard并使用AES对其加密的应用程序,以后将由台式机应用程序使用.我注意到,如果不从“设置"菜单中卸载SD卡,有时文件根本不会被写入或损坏. 无论如何,在Android 2.1中是否可以通过编程方式卸载SDCard?因为我非常确定用户会不时忘记这样做,所以我将成为解决问题的人,我真的不想要这样做. 如果这不可能,那么我应该使用什么Linux命令来卸载SDCa
..
是否有一种方法可以限制Android上使用ManagedQuery函数从媒体存储中检索到的结果.由于我目前有一个网格,可显示在SD卡上找到的所有照片,但提取起来过于繁琐,因此我决定限制从媒体存储中检索到的结果,但找不到可以减少结果数据集的限制功能 请帮助 解决方案 在contentresolver的查询方法中使用顺序来实现您的功能, 例如“列名升序限制编号" 就我而言:
..
我正在尝试使用Phonegap打开SD卡并在Android中上传文件.以下是我将SD卡内容附加到HTML的代码,但未显示任何内容.我正在使用cordova.js,jquery1.7.1.js.下面是我的代码: 我的Javascript: function onDeviceReady() { getFileSystem(); } function getFileSystem()
..
如果事实证明这是一个愚蠢的问题我很抱歉,它可能会成为一个快速解决方案,但我无法弄明白。我正在android studio中构建一个音乐播放器,并且sdcard上的所有歌曲都没有显示在列表视图中,只有内部存储器中的那些,即使我确实实现了getExternalStorageDirectory()并在清单文件中添加了权限。 关于这个或建设性批评的任何意见都是非常苛刻的。这是主要的java类。 公
..
我正在使用Exoplayer演示应用,并希望从SD卡预加载MP4视频。 我已经尝试过这篇文章,但它不起作用。在我的exoplayer Demo中没有名为DemoUtil.java的类。 改为使用: public static final Sample [] LOCAL_VIDEOS = new Sample [] { new Sample (“视频1的一些用户友好名称”, “/mnt
..
我使用的是三星A3,Android 5.0.2。我正在使用此设置来编译应用程序,即Android 4.1 Jelly Bean(API 16)目标。 我确切地知道外部可移动microSD卡的路径,它是 / mnt / extSdCard / (另见下面的注释#7) 。 问题:我注意到 文件myDir = new File ( “/ MNT / extSdCard /测试”);
..
这是我的代码: boolean success = false; Log.d(TAG,Environment.getExternalStorageDirectory()+“/”+ Environment.DIRECTORY_PICTURES +“/ myFolder”); myFolder = new File(Environment.getExternalStorageDirec
..
stopWriting =(Button)findViewById(R.id.save); stopWriting.setOnClickListener(new OnClickListener(){ @SuppressLint(“SdCardPath”) public void onClick(View v){ //停止记录传感器data try { myFile = n
..
我正在使用外部SD卡的PersistableUriPermission并将其存储以供进一步使用。 现在我希望当用户向我提供文件路径时,从我的应用程序中的文件列表中,我想编辑文档并重新命名它。 所以我有文件的路径来编辑。 我的问题是如何从我的TreeUri得到该文件的Uri作为编辑文件。访问Sd卡的文件 $ b 解决方案使用 DOCUMENT_TREE 对话框获取sd-card
..
如何将图像保存到从图像网址中检索到的SD卡? 解决方案 确保您的应用程序有权写入SD卡。为此,您需要在应用程序清单文件中添加使用权限写入外部存储。请参阅设置Android权限 然后,您可以将URL下载到sdcard上的文件。一个简单的方法是: URL url = new URL(“file://some/path/anImage.png”); InputStream in
..
解决方案 常规Java文件IO: > 文件f = new File(Environment.getExternalStorageDirectory()+“/ somedir”); if(f.isDirectory()){ .... 可能还要检查 f.exists(),因为如果它存在,而 isDirectory()返回false,你会有问题。还有 isReadable
..
我使用以下代码,发布在Stack Overflow的某处,并为了我的目的修改: try { 文件sd = Environment.getExternalStorageDirectory(); 文件数据= Environment.getDataDirectory(); if(sd.canWrite()){ String currentDBPath =“// data //”+“c
..
我使用自定义视图,在我使用一个画布,用户可以在其中绘制任何东西,之后,我想保存该图像在SD卡bt无法做到这一点。不知道发生了什么。 else if(view.getId()== R.id.save_btn){ // save drawing AlertDialog.Builder saveDialog = new AlertDialog.Builder(this); saveDi
..
我的SD卡的权限是Irwxrwxrwx 我不能推它的任何文件
..